Dragpa Öser (Imperial Teacher)
Dragpa Öser ( Tib . : grags pa ´od zer; Chinese 扎巴 俄 色 (乞 刺 斯 八 斡 节 儿) , Pinyin Daba Ese (Qicisibawojier) ) (* 1246 ; † 1303 ) was Phagpa's personal advisor. From 1291 to 1303 he was the imperial teacher ( dishi / ti shri ) of the Mongol emperors Shizu (Kublai Khan) and Chengzong (Timur Khan / Öljeytü Qaγan). He was the fifth person to serve as the central government's highest monk official for Buddhist affairs.
